Keyboard shortcuts

Press or to navigate between chapters

Press S or / to search in the book

Press ? to show this help

Press Esc to hide this help

flavor_tur.98 法兰西的戏剧(由 flavor_tur.96 触发)

时间范围:无特定时间范围(fromto 未在代码中定义),事件触发概率未指定(monthly_chance 未在代码中定义)。

触发条件

  • 国家必须拥有一位君主。
  • 当前君主必须拥有变量 ruler_at_time_of_tur_96
  • 国家 FRA(法兰西)必须存在。

关键效果

  • 选项 A (flavor_tur.98.a)
    • 历史选项:是
    • 获得少量政府力量加成 (government_power_mild_bonus)。
  • 选项 B (flavor_tur.98.b)
    • 根据法兰西对本国(奥斯曼)的态度产生不同效果:
      • 如果法兰西对本国态度 ≤ 50:法兰西将拒绝请求,并获得对本国“无理要求”的负面意见修正 (outrageous_demands),同时本国获得少量威望加成 (prestige_weak_bonus)。
      • 如果法兰西对本国态度 > 50:法兰西将同意请求,并获得对本国“奥斯曼宫廷的求爱”的正面意见修正 (tur_courting_the_sublime_porte),同时本国获得中等威望加成 (prestige_mild_bonus)。
  • 选项 C (flavor_tur.98.c)
    • 触发条件:国家稳定度低于 90。
    • 获得少量稳定度加成 (stability_weak_bonus)。
    • 降低贵族阶层满意度 0.20 (add_estate_satisfaction = { type = estate_type:nobles_estate value = -0.20 })。

背景介绍: 此事件是奥斯曼帝国历史事件链条中的一环,由前序事件 flavor_tur.96 触发。它模拟了奥斯曼宫廷在处理与法兰西王国关系时可能面临的外交抉择。事件标题“法兰西的戏剧”暗示了这可能涉及一场外交博弈或文化事件,需要君主在巩固国内统治、争取外部支持或安抚内部贵族等不同策略间做出选择。

完整事件代码

flavor_tur.98 = { #The French Play, triggered by flavor_tur.96
	type = country_event
	title = flavor_tur.98.title
	desc = flavor_tur.98.desc

	historical_info = flavor_tur.98.historical_info

	trigger = {

		has_ruler = yes

		ruler ?= {
			has_variable = ruler_at_time_of_tur_96
		}

		country_exists = c:FRA

	}

	immediate =  {

		root.ruler = { save_scope_as = target_ruler }

	}

	option = {
		name = flavor_tur.98.a
		historical_option = yes

		add_government_power = government_power_mild_bonus
	}

	option = {
		name = flavor_tur.98.b


		if = {
			limit = {
				c:FRA = {
					opinion = { target = c:TUR value <= 50 }
				}
			}
			custom_tooltip = france_will_refuse.tt
			c:FRA = {
				add_opinion = {
					target = root
					modifier = outrageous_demands
				}
			}
			add_prestige = prestige_weak_bonus
		}
		else = {
			custom_tooltip = france_will_aquiesce.tt
			c:FRA = {
				add_opinion = {
					target = root
					modifier = tur_courting_the_sublime_porte
				}
			}
			add_prestige = prestige_mild_bonus
		}
	}

	option = {
		name = flavor_tur.98.c

		trigger = {
			stability < 90
		}

		add_stability = stability_weak_bonus

		add_estate_satisfaction = { type = estate_type:nobles_estate value = -0.20 }
	}

	after = {

		remove_variable = ruler_at_time_of_tur_96
	}
}